  7. Not a fan of the scabbards. I see more shooters that use scabbards sweep the hand that's holding the scabbard when removing the rifle with the other hand. I prefer the inexpensive type of zippered case like this one: Amazon link The closed cases did much better than the scabbards this weekend when we had rain on both days of a match. I also saw a PCC fall out of a scabbard once when the shooter's gun cart fell over. If you prefer the scabbards, just be aware of the increased hand sweep potential when withdrawing the gun.

  14. We don't do many reloads in PCC so I wouldn't make reload times your primary decision factor. However, since the EndoMag maxes out at 30 rounds, that will cause you to do a reload on a 32 round stage versus other shooters running Glock/Colt mags with a magblock or dedicated lower who won't need to reload. You have options ... for roughly $200 you can buy 4 EndoMags, or a dedicated Glock or Colt style AR9 lower, or a magblock to use with your current 223 lower. If the EndoMag works well, maybe we can convince them to make it for 40 round PMAGS.
